Royal Holloway, University of LondonEconomics with Political Studies with a Year in Business BSc Econ H is an undergraduate degree at Royal Holloway, University of London, based in Egham, taught full-time over 4 years. 83% of final-year students rated the course positively in the National Student Survey, and graduates earn £30,000 on average 15 months after finishing. Typical A-level entry is ABB - BBB.

About this course
Studying Economics with Political Studies at Royal Holloway means that you will learn from internationally renowned experts at one of the UK’s top ten teaching and research centres. Economics is one of the most influential and liveliest disciplines in today's world, affecting the lives and fortunes of everyone on the planet. This course offers a complete education in the theories and methods of economics, with a strong focus on analytical methods and a quarter of your time will be spent on political studies. The knowledge and transferable skills gained will lead to excellent career prospects in public and private management, financial institutions and in government.
Through your studies you will develop an in-depth understanding of economics at all levels – from the company to the state, and beyond. You will learn to appreciate and apply the core theories of micro and macroeconomics; gain important quantitative and computing skills that are widely applicable as well as skills in logical reasoning and gain experience in logical and philosophical reasoning. You will also gain a grounding in politics by analysing and criticising classic and contemporary texts and exploring political ideas and processes in countries throughout the world and the global system. By electing to spend a year in business you will also be able to integrate theory and practice.
Our balanced approach to research and teaching guarantees high quality teaching from subject leaders, cutting edge materials and intellectually challenging debates. Our courses follow a coherent and developmental structure which we combined with an effective and flexible approach to study.
- Study academic politics and be introduced to the ‘real world’ of contemporary politics.
- Cover micro and macro-economics to build a solid foundation of economic theory.
- See how economics and politics combine and challenge the world around them.
- Opportunity to undertake a dissertation to explore an in-depth topic you are passionate about.
